To become a successful programmer one needs to know about algorithms, data structure and mathematics. In mathematics you should know the topics like linear algebra, set theories, discrete math, number theory and some calculus. You don't need to be scholar in maths but basic concepts and problem solv

There are over 1300 seats available for BA LLB programme in the affiliated colleges of SPPU. Out of the total seats, 85% seats are reserved for candidates with Maharashtra domicile.

BA LLB admission at SPPU is aligned with MH (Law) CET dates. Admission is administered through Maharashtra CET. Online registration for Centralised Admission Process (CAP) for BA LLB is open currently.
